The Rise of Advertising in AI Assistants

1/14/2026, 12:52:06 AM

Core Event: Introduction of Ads in AI Platforms

Advertising is making its way into artificial intelligence platforms, with Google leading the charge by integrating ads into its AI helpers. This development marks a significant shift in how advertising is delivered, moving beyond traditional media into spaces previously considered commercial-free.

Background & Context: Evolution of Advertising

The advertising landscape has evolved significantly over the years, with brands increasingly seeking innovative ways to reach consumers. Historically, advertising was confined to television, radio, and print media. However, the rise of digital platforms has led to ads infiltrating streaming services, online shopping, and even physical environments like Uber rides and restaurant deliveries. This trend has paved the way for the introduction of ads in AI technologies.

Key Figures & Groups: Google’s Role

Google, a leader in the technology sector, is at the forefront of this advertising evolution. The company’s AI assistants are now being tested for ad placements, indicating a strategic move to monetize its AI capabilities. This initiative reflects Google's broader business model, which relies heavily on advertising revenue.

Why It Matters: Implications for Users and Advertisers

The integration of ads into AI platforms could reshape user experiences. For consumers, this may lead to a more commercialized interaction with AI, potentially affecting how they perceive and utilize these technologies. For advertisers, it opens new avenues for targeting consumers in more personalized and direct ways, leveraging AI's capabilities to reach audiences effectively.

Criticism & Opposition: Concerns Over User Experience

Critics of this trend express concerns about the potential for diminished user experience. The introduction of ads in AI assistants could lead to intrusive advertising practices, which may frustrate users who expect a seamless and ad-free interaction. There is also apprehension regarding data privacy and how user information may be utilized to tailor advertisements.
